Drop or Rise
If you are intending for towing, and mostly that’s the case, level towing is the fundamental thing to ensure. Drop or rise is the deviation of the height of the trailer coupler from the height of the trailer hitch receiver.
The most top branded receiver comes with a drop or rise of 7 to 8 inches at best. Don’t worry if it doesn’t match your needs. Just buy a hitch receiver with ball mount height adjustability.
Why determine it?
For low ball mount set up i.e. drop, the resultant weight of the trailer and what’s on it is going to take the weight off your towing vehicle’s front. In such cases, both braking and steering of the car is affected and may lead to accidents.
Whereas, if you rise that higher than your requirement, the weight behind the axles of the trailer gets displaced and you result in a wobbling of the trailer.
How to determine it?
Measure the height of the receiver at the back of your car. Next, level out your trailer and measure the coupler height. Obviously both the measurements should be from ground level. The difference between the two will be your required drop or rise to obtain from the hitch receiver you install.
To be specific, subtract the receiver height (A) from the coupler height (B). If the result (C = B-A) is negative, the result will indicate a drop while a positive difference means its rise.
1. Load Capacity
As the name suggests, the term refers to how much the receiver can handle without any obvious issue. If you want to tow a bigger trailer, it’s obvious that you have to go for a bigger load capacity which may force you to increase your budget.
There’s a thumb rule to select the perfect one. Choose a trailer hitch receiver that is capable of towing more than the weight of your trailer. It’ll be excellent if that’s nearly double. This safety measure will definitely help you to cruise further and able to retain the durability of the ball mount.
2. Class
Society of Automotive Engineers (SAE) has defined four types of trailer hitches. Starting from the load-carrying capacity up to 2000 lbs to 10,000 lbs. There’s another type that can carry up to 17,000 lbs. These categories are defined as class ranging from I to V according to the weight carrying capacity. Higher classes cost more but worths spending.

4. Material
In general, steel is the primary material that is used to build the trailer hitch receiver. Forged steel is better and found among the top class receivers. Heat-treated hardened steel is also a fantastic choice.
But it may catch rust and soon become fragile. That’s why manufacturers use to coat the body with a proper layer of paint. While some others provide powder coating. Stainless steel can be a good alternative to prevent rust.
